Management Commentary

During the accompanying earnings call for the previous quarter, Wendy’s leadership focused on operational milestones advanced over the quarter, without disclosing specific prepared quotes as part of this initial update. Management highlighted several key priorities that the company progressed during the period, including the nationwide rollout of new limited-time menu offerings, expansion of its digital delivery partner network, and increased support for franchise owners to upgrade in-store and drive-thru technology. Leadership also addressed the absence of full revenue data in the initial release, confirming that complete audited financial statements will be filed with regulatory bodies in the upcoming weeks, and that no material discrepancies have been identified during the ongoing reconciliation process. Management also noted that customer satisfaction scores for drive-thru and digital orders improved in recent months, a trend the company attributes to investments in staff training and order processing technology. Forward Guidance

Wendy’s did not release specific quantitative forward guidance as part of its initial the previous quarter earnings announcement, but leadership outlined broad strategic priorities for the upcoming months. These priorities include expanding the company’s international footprint in high-growth emerging markets, rolling out enhancements to its consumer loyalty program, and launching additional cost efficiency initiatives to offset potential commodity and labor cost pressures. Analysts covering WEN estimate that the company may face modest headwinds from rising food input costs in the near term, though ongoing pricing adjustments and operational optimizations could partially mitigate these impacts. Market observers also note that Wendy’s focus on value menu offerings may position it well to capture market share if consumer discretionary spending slows in the coming months, though this potential upside remains subject to broader macroeconomic conditions. Market Reaction

Following the release of the initial the previous quarter earnings results, WEN shares saw mixed trading activity in recent sessions, with volume trending slightly above average in the days immediately after the announcement. Sell-side analysts covering the stock have published mixed reactions to the reported EPS figure, with most noting that the $0.16 per share result is roughly aligned with broad market expectations, while several have flagged the lack of accompanying revenue data as a source of near-term uncertainty for investors. The stock’s price action has also tracked trends across the broader restaurant peer group, which has seen elevated volatility in recent weeks as market participants weigh the impact of shifting consumer spending patterns on sector performance. Some analysts have highlighted Wendy’s ongoing investments in digital and drive-thru infrastructure as a potential long-term growth driver, though the near-term trajectory of WEN’s share price may be heavily influenced by the content of the full the previous quarter financial filing when it is released later this month.
